32nd Sunday in Ordinary Time
The month of November is here with its short days and long dark nights.
The year is dying.
It’s a suitable time to remember our dead,
not with fear and despair,
but in the hope of joining them in eternal life.

Come and See Weekend at St. Peter’s Seminary
For single Catholic men 17 yrs and older. November 26-28 and March 4-6 at St. Peter’s Seminary in London, ON. Consider your calling in life while seeing what it is like to be called to the priesthood. There are times for prayer, reflection, discussion and leisure as seminary faculty and seminarians share their experiences of God’s call in their own lives.

Prayer for Deceased Relatives and Friends

Almighty Father,
source of forgiveness and salvation,
grant that our relatives and friends who have passed from this life may,
through the intercession of the Blessed Virgin Mary and of all the saints,
come to share your eternal happiness through Christ our Lord. 
Amen
